Obituary of Vera Kersell

     Vera Kersell earned her angel wings and entered eternal life on July 10, 2023 in Bradenton, FL where she resided. Vera was born in Columbus, Ohio on March 16, 1928 and raised her family there for many years before moving to CT and FL. She was predeceased by her beloved husband Jim in 2008 after 60 years of marriage. She was also predeceased by her parents Bill and Vivian Lape, Tony and Lena Mitchell and two sisters JoAnn and Bernadine. She leaves behind her son Robert Kersell (Faye) of Sun City, FL her daughter Sandra Kersell and her daughter in law of 30 years Vicki Russo of Niantic, CT and grandchildren Erin Macri (Jonathan) of Owings, MD Brent Kersell (Stephanie) of Virginia Beach, VA and her great grandson Domenic Macri. She also leaves behind many friends in FL, CT, and Ohio. Vera was full of life, she loved music, dancing, tap dancing, going to the beach in Madison CT where she and Jim lived for many years. She also loved dining with family and friends and of course enjoying her wine. She was also an avid bowler in her earlier years then resorted to playing Wii bowling most recently just months ago. She was a religious person and attended church regularly and made sure to read her prayer books every day and say her prayers at night. During the last week of her time on this earth, Vicki and Sandy made sure to read her Jesus Calling and Heaven Calling prayer books to her. She volunteered over the years for many charities and in hospital emergency rooms. She will be deeply missed by her family and friends. In her memory please do something kind for someone in need or if you are able make a donation to a charity of your choice. A memorial service and celebration of life will be held at the convenience of the family at a later date.
